Robots Helped Capture Boston Bombing Suspect

Charlie Vaida, a spokesman for iRobot, confirmed in a statement to Mashable that its PackBot model was used by the Boston Police Department. The PackBot is a remote-controlled tactical mobile robot with the capability of detecting and disposing of certain explosive devices.
